European Health Data Space

The European Health Data Space is a proposal from the European Comission.

The initiative aims to:

  1. Support individuals to take control of their own health data.
  2. Support the use of health data for better healthcare delivery, better research, innovation and policy making.
  3. Enable the EU to make full use of the potential offered by a safe and secure exchange, use and reuse of health data.

The European Health Data Space is a health-specific ecosystem comprised of rules, common standards and practices, infrastructures and a governance framework. Consultations with the European Council and European Parliament are scheduled for the next three years.

IDERHA’s pilot program aims to develop one of the first pan-European health data spaces.
